Understanding Milk Teeth: The First Smile Milestone
Milk teeth, often called baby teeth or primary teeth, are the initial set of teeth that appear in infants. These tiny pearly whites typically begin to emerge around six months of age and serve as placeholders for permanent teeth. Far from just being cute, milk teeth play a vital role in a child’s early development. They help babies chew solid foods, support clear speech formation, and maintain space for the adult teeth that will eventually replace them.
The term “milk teeth” stems from their appearance during infancy when babies primarily consume milk before transitioning to solid foods. These teeth are smaller and whiter than adult teeth, with thinner enamel layers. Despite their temporary nature, they are critical to oral health and overall wellbeing.
The Timeline of Milk Teeth Eruption
Milk teeth erupt in a fairly predictable sequence, although there’s some variation from child to child. The process usually starts between 4 to 7 months and continues until about age 3 when all 20 primary teeth have typically appeared.
The order generally follows this pattern:
- Lower central incisors: The two front bottom teeth usually come in first.
- Upper central incisors: Next are the two front top teeth.
- Lateral incisors: Teeth next to the central incisors on both top and bottom.
- First molars: Located behind the canines, these help with chewing.
- Canines (cuspids): Pointed teeth beside lateral incisors.
- Second molars: The last set of milk teeth appearing at the back.
This eruption timeline can vary by several months. Some babies might get their first tooth as early as three months or as late as one year without cause for concern.
Anatomy and Structure of Milk Teeth
Milk teeth share many structural features with permanent adult teeth but have some distinct differences suited for infancy and childhood.
Each milk tooth consists of:
- Crown: The visible white part covered by enamel.
- Enamel: A thinner layer compared to adult teeth but still protective.
- Dentin: Beneath enamel; softer than adult dentin.
- Pulp: Contains nerves and blood vessels essential for tooth vitality.
- Root: Anchors the tooth into the jawbone but is resorbed later to allow shedding.
The roots of milk teeth are shorter and more slender than permanent ones because they need to be resorbed naturally as permanent successors develop underneath.
The Difference Between Milk Teeth and Permanent Teeth
While both sets perform similar functions, milk teeth differ significantly:
| Feature | Milk Teeth | Permanent Teeth |
|---|---|---|
| Total Number | 20 (10 upper + 10 lower) | 32 (16 upper + 16 lower) |
| Eruption Age | 6 months – 3 years | 6 years – late teens/early twenties |
| Enamel Thickness | Thinner enamel layer | Thicker enamel layer for durability |
| Root Structure | Softer roots designed for resorption | Tougher roots designed for permanence |
| Lifespan | Temporary; shed by ages 6-12 years | Permanent; meant to last a lifetime |
This table highlights why milk teeth need extra care despite their temporary status—they lay the groundwork for healthy adult dentition.
The Importance of Milk Teeth Care and Maintenance
Milk teeth might seem temporary, but neglecting them can lead to problems like cavities, infections, or misaligned permanent teeth. Early dental hygiene starts even before the first tooth appears by wiping gums with a clean cloth after feeding.
Once the first tooth erupts:
- Brush twice daily: Use a soft-bristled toothbrush designed for infants with a small amount of fluoride toothpaste (pea-sized).
- Avoid sugary drinks: Frequent exposure increases cavity risk dramatically.
- Avoid prolonged bottle feeding at night: This can cause “baby bottle tooth decay.”
Regular dental check-ups should begin around the child’s first birthday or within six months after their first tooth emerges. Dentists can monitor growth patterns and spot issues early.
The Impact of Early Tooth Decay on Development
Cavities in milk teeth aren’t just cosmetic—they can cause pain, infections, difficulty eating, and speech problems. Untreated decay may lead to premature loss of baby teeth, disrupting space maintenance for adult successors.
This can result in crowding or crooked permanent teeth requiring orthodontic treatment later on. Therefore, prioritizing oral hygiene from infancy pays dividends down the road.
The Shedding Process: When Milk Teeth Make Way for Permanent Ones
Around age six, children start losing their milk teeth—a process called exfoliation—to make room for permanent replacements. This natural cycle continues until roughly age twelve when most primary molars give way.
The shedding happens because roots dissolve gradually beneath each baby tooth as permanent tooth buds push upward. This loosens milk teeth until they fall out naturally or with gentle wiggling.
Commonly lost baby teeth sequence:
- The lower central incisors fall out first.
- This is followed by upper central incisors.
- Lateral incisors shed next.
- The molars and canines come out last.
During this phase, kids may experience mild discomfort or slight gum swelling but should not suffer severe pain. Parents should encourage gentle wiggling rather than forceful pulling.

The Role of Milk Teeth Beyond Chewing: Speech & Jaw Development
Milk teeth don’t just help munch food; they’re crucial players in speech clarity too. They provide necessary contact points inside the mouth that guide tongue placement while forming sounds like “t,” “d,” “s,” and “th.”
Missing or decayed baby teeth may cause lisps or pronunciation difficulties that affect communication skills during formative years.
Moreover, these primary sets guide jawbone growth properly by stimulating bone tissue through chewing forces. Healthy milk teeth encourage symmetrical jaw development which supports facial aesthetics later on.
The Consequences of Premature Loss or Absence of Milk Teeth
If baby teeth are lost too early due to trauma or decay:
- The adjacent permanent tooth buds might drift into empty spaces prematurely causing crowding issues later.
Dentists sometimes use space maintainers—small devices placed inside the mouth—to preserve gaps until permanent successors arrive naturally.
Children born without certain baby teeth (a condition called hypodontia) also face risks like delayed eruption or missing permanent counterparts requiring specialized dental care plans.
Nutritional Influence on Healthy Milk Teeth Development
Good nutrition fuels strong bones and healthy tooth formation right from pregnancy through infancy. Key nutrients include:
- Calcium: Builds strong enamel and bones;
- Vitamin D: Helps absorb calcium effectively;
- Phosphorus: Works alongside calcium;
- Adequate protein intake supports overall growth including dental tissues;
Breastfeeding provides many essential nutrients promoting optimal dental health during infancy while introducing balanced solid foods rich in vitamins supports ongoing development once teething begins.
Avoiding excessive sugary snacks reduces acid attacks that erode enamel prematurely causing cavities even in young children’s fragile milk dentition.
The Science Behind Tooth Development: How Milk Teeth Form In Utero And Beyond
Tooth development starts surprisingly early—around six weeks gestation—when specialized cells called odontoblasts begin forming dental tissues inside fetal jaws long before birth. By about four months into pregnancy, initial buds representing future milk tooth crowns form beneath gums already shaping hard structures like enamel matrix and dentin layers gradually mineralizing over time.
After birth, these primed buds continue developing roots while erupting sequentially according to genetic programming combined with environmental influences like nutrition status or illness episodes affecting growth pace temporarily.
Understanding this complex choreography helps explain why some infants experience delayed teething while others burst onto milestones earlier without issues—both within normal biological variation ranges reflecting individual uniqueness rather than pathology necessarily requiring intervention unless accompanied by other symptoms affecting health directly.
